THE WRITER Howard Fast is best known as the author of Spartacus, the novel that Kirk Douglas and Stanley Kubrick turned into an epic movie in 1960. Yet, over a 70-year writing career Fast wrote more than 80 books which sold over 80 million copies around the world.
He was a Communist and in 1953 became the only American apart from Paul Robeson to receive the Stalin International Peace Prize. Three years later, he left the Communist Party when Nikita Khrushchev revealed Stalin's murderous ways.
